The Federal Government on Tuesday threw its weight on the proscription of the Indigenous People of Biafra, IPOB, and the categorisation of IPOB as a terrorist organisation by both the south-east governors and the Nigerian army, respectively, saying the activities of the group are similar to those of other terrorist groups.
The Minister of Information and Culture, Alhaji Lai Mohammed disclosed this on Tuesday when he appeared on a live TV programme “Good Morning Nigeria” on NTA.
According to him, federal government equally knows the foreign countries supporting and funding the activities of IPOB in Nigeria and has kick-started steps at blocking IPOB’s funding.
Lai Mohammed also said IPOB has written to foreign countries, lying to them that Nigeria is a country where Muslims persecute Christians and that in Nigeria, genocide is carried out by the state.
According to him, “There are a lot of arguments regarding the constitutionality of the action of the military and the South East governors.
“People must realise that we are dealing with issue of national security and I do not think that the military and the governors should fold their arms while the country is set ablaze.
“I have heard a lot of comments as to whether the military has the right to declare IPOB, a terrorist group “What the military has done is to catalogue all the activities of IPOB, which are not different from that of terrorists groups,” he said.
He added that IPOB set up a para-military organisation, a parallel military group, Biafra Secret Service and Biafra National Guard. These actions are clearly against the law.
